-
公开(公告)号:DE69813911D1
公开(公告)日:2003-05-28
申请号:DE69813911
申请日:1998-10-13
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I , OH LYE , BARD JEAN-MICHEL
IPC: H04N7/26
-
公开(公告)号:DE69816875T2
公开(公告)日:2004-04-22
申请号:DE69816875
申请日:1998-05-30
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I
Abstract: A method and apparatus for encoding pictures of a moving pictures sequence according to an overall target bit-rate, such as in a MPEG video encoder. Each picture has an assigned picture coding type for which a quality factor is adaptively determined according to past bit usages, so that bits can be adaptively allocated amongst picture types for optimizing visual quality of the encoded pictures.
-
公开(公告)号:DE69813911T2
公开(公告)日:2004-02-05
申请号:DE69813911
申请日:1998-10-13
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I , OH LYE , BARD JEAN-MICHEL
IPC: H04N7/26
-
-
公开(公告)号:DE69736440D1
公开(公告)日:2006-09-14
申请号:DE69736440
申请日:1997-09-26
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I
IPC: H04H20/88
Abstract: A method and apparatus for decoding a multi-channel audio bitstream in which adaptive frequency domain downmixer (3) is used to downmix, according to long and shorter transform block length information (17), the decoded frequency coefficients of the multi-channel audio (12,13,14,15) such that the long and shorter transform block information is maintained separately within the mixed down left and right channels. In this way, the long and shorter transform block coefficients of the mixed down let and right channels can be inverse transformed adaptively (4,5,6,7) according to the long and shorter transform block information, and the results of the inverse transform of the long and short block of each the left and right channel added together (8,9) to form the total mixed down output of the left and right channel.
-
公开(公告)号:DE69734782D1
公开(公告)日:2006-01-05
申请号:DE69734782
申请日:1997-09-26
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I , GEORGE SAPNA
IPC: H04H20/88
Abstract: A method and apparatus for decoding a bitstream (100) of transform coded multi-channel audio data. The bitstream is subjected to a block decoding process (101) to obtain for each input audio channel within the multi-channel audio data a corresponding block of frequency coefficients (102). Each block of frequency coefficients (102) is assigned a higher precision inverse transform or a lower precision inverse transform according to predetermined characteristics of the audio data represented by the block. The blocks of frequency coefficients are subsequently subjected to the assigned transform (105, 106) and an output audio signal (108) is generated in response to each of the higher and lower precision inverse transform processes.
-
公开(公告)号:DE69813632T2
公开(公告)日:2004-01-29
申请号:DE69813632
申请日:1998-05-12
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I
IPC: H04N7/50
Abstract: This method and apparatus described herein imposes masking factors to the determined quantization step sizes of macroblocks of a video sequence such that encoding efficiency is increased. A conditional masking method can be used to take advantage of the fact that P-pictures are more important than B-pictures in terms of motion and scene updates as coding noise in such updates are likely propagated by P-pictures. The masking can be applied conditionally to motion/scene update regions of a picture such that coding noise is reduced and therefore bits are saved from less propagation of this noise. Before encoding each macroblock of a picture from an input video sequence, a video encoder with conditional masking determines if the macroblock type belongs to a significant motion or scene update region. A conditional masking factor is then determined for the macroblock based on the determined macroblock type and the picture coding type.The conditional masking factor is combined with a macroblock reference quantization step-size which may be calculated using conventional methods based on bit allocation and bit utilization, and an optional activity masking factor based on activity level of the macroblock and/or its surrounding region to form the final quantization step-size for coding of the macroblock.
-
公开(公告)号:DE69816875D1
公开(公告)日:2003-09-04
申请号:DE69816875
申请日:1998-05-30
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I
Abstract: A method and apparatus for encoding pictures of a moving pictures sequence according to an overall target bit-rate, such as in a MPEG video encoder. Each picture has an assigned picture coding type for which a quality factor is adaptively determined according to past bit usages, so that bits can be adaptively allocated amongst picture types for optimizing visual quality of the encoded pictures.
-
-
公开(公告)号:DE69813632D1
公开(公告)日:2003-05-22
申请号:DE69813632
申请日:1998-05-12
Applicant: ST MICROELECTRONICS ASIA
Inventor: HUI WAI
IPC: H04N7/50
Abstract: This method and apparatus described herein imposes masking factors to the determined quantization step sizes of macroblocks of a video sequence such that encoding efficiency is increased. A conditional masking method can be used to take advantage of the fact that P-pictures are more important than B-pictures in terms of motion and scene updates as coding noise in such updates are likely propagated by P-pictures. The masking can be applied conditionally to motion/scene update regions of a picture such that coding noise is reduced and therefore bits are saved from less propagation of this noise. Before encoding each macroblock of a picture from an input video sequence, a video encoder with conditional masking determines if the macroblock type belongs to a significant motion or scene update region. A conditional masking factor is then determined for the macroblock based on the determined macroblock type and the picture coding type.The conditional masking factor is combined with a macroblock reference quantization step-size which may be calculated using conventional methods based on bit allocation and bit utilization, and an optional activity masking factor based on activity level of the macroblock and/or its surrounding region to form the final quantization step-size for coding of the macroblock.
-
-
-
-
-
-
-
-
-